did not see this posted anywhere else but UFC.com posted the main card for The Fight night coming up. Nate Diaz vs. Neer is going to be the main event.
Main Card:
Nate Diaz Vs. Josh Neer
Clay Guida Vs. Mac Danzig
Houston Alexander Vs. Eric Schafer
Ed Herman Vs. Alan Belcher
Joe Lauzon Vs. Kyle Bradley
No announced undercard yet
